2013-10-03 49 views
0

我有一個SSRS報告,在預覽模式下不顯示數據。但是,當我在SQL Server 2008 R2中運行相同的查詢時,我可以檢索結果SSRS不顯示數據,但在tsql中運行查詢時顯示數據

這是什麼原因造成的?

我也使用Set FMTOnly關閉,因爲我使用了temptables。

+0

您可能存在錯誤的緩存數據 - 嘗試關閉BIDS,刪除項目文件夾中的所有* .rdl.data文件,然後重新加載報告。 –

+0

@IprPreston我在哪裏可以看到rdl數據文件?對不起,我是新來的。 – user2705620

+0

它們將與實際的rdl文件位於相同的位置;這取決於你如何設置你的項目/解決方案。只需進入根解決方案目錄並搜索該文件夾和所有子文件夾。 –

回答

2

如果使用「SQL Server商業智能開發工作室」而不是「報表生成器」,然後點擊報告服務(這裏是你的表):

  1. 點擊查看 - >屬性窗口(或者直接按F4)
  2. 選擇在屬性窗口中的表矩陣
  3. 找到「常規」,並在「DataSetName的」選擇你的「數據集」
  4. 在表矩陣領域從「數據集」
設定值

或者只是不喜歡這裏(從8:50):http://www.youtube.com/watch?v=HM_dquiikBA

0

一種解決方法應該是:

1)選擇參數並點擊查看報告(你不會看到什麼或某些細胞會顯示內容,有些不是)

2)單擊打印佈局(旁邊的打印機)

你將能夠看到的內容。如果您有展開/摺疊功能,那麼您將無法與用戶界面進行交互。